In Yukio Mishima's 'After the Banquet,' Kazu, a spirited middle-aged restaurateur catering to Tokyo's political elite, falls in love with Noguchi, a principled politician. As Kazu wholeheartedly dedicates herself to advancing his career, she finds her personal desires clashing with public life, navigating a world where ambition, integrity, and the pursuit of power collide amidst the changing landscape of post-war Japan. Mishima meticulously examines the moral complexities and societal pressures faced by characters forced to confront their choices.
